CA — Chartered Accountancy
Entrance: CA Foundation (ICAI)
The gold standard of Commerce careers. CA is India's most respected financial qualification. Three stages: Foundation, Intermediate, Final plus 3 years of articleship training.
BBA / BMS (Management)
Entrance: CUET · IPMAT (IIM Indore / Rohtak) · SET
Bachelor of Business Administration or Business Management Studies. A gateway to MBA from top IIMs. Covers marketing, finance, HR, and operations in a broad management curriculum.
B.Com Hons / B.Com
Entrance: CUET · University Merit
The classic foundation for finance, accounting, and banking careers. B.Com Hons from Delhi University or top colleges is highly respected and opens diverse career paths.
BBA LLB / B.Com LLB
Entrance: CLAT · AILET · LSAT India
Integrated law program combining commerce with legal expertise. Perfect for students wanting corporate law, taxation law, or business litigation careers at top law firms.
CMA — Cost Management Accountant
Entrance: CMA Foundation (ICMAI)
CMA from ICMAI is a professional accounting qualification focused on cost management and management accounting. Strong demand in manufacturing and BFSI sectors.
Economics Hons / B.Sc Economics
Entrance: CUET · University Merit
Economics Hons from top universities opens doors to RBI, SEBI, Indian Economic Service, investment banking, and policy research. Requires a strong quantitative foundation.

How to Become a CA After 12th
Step-by-step path to Chartered Accountancy — India's highest-paying professional qualification for Commerce students.
Clear 12th with Commerce
Minimum 50% marks required to register for CA Foundation. Stream: Commerce, Maths is optional.
CA Foundation
4 papers covering Principles of Accounting, Business Laws, Quantitative Aptitude, and Business Economics. Study duration: 4 months.
CA Intermediate
8 papers in 2 groups covering advanced accounting, taxation, law, audit, and finance. Duration: approx. 8 months per group.
3-Year Articleship
Practical training under a CA firm. Simultaneously prepare for CA Final exams. Stipend: Rs. 5,000–20,000 per month.
CA Final
8 papers in 2 groups including Advanced Financial Reporting, SFM, and Electives. Clearing this makes you a Chartered Accountant.

What are the best career options after 12th Commerce?
Top options: CA (7–25 LPA), BBA/BMS (3–20 LPA), B.Com Hons (3–15 LPA), BBA LLB (5–30 LPA), CMA (5–18 LPA), and Economics Hons (4–20 LPA).
Can Commerce students without Maths pursue good careers?
Yes. CA, CS, B.Com, BBA, Law via CLAT, Mass Communication, Hotel Management, and Fashion Design do not require Maths in 12th. Most professional courses like CA and CS have their own entrance exams.
How to become a CA after 12th?
Register for CA Foundation with ICAI, clear Foundation (4 papers), CA Intermediate (8 papers), complete 3-year articleship, then clear CA Final. Total duration approx. 5 years. Starting salary: Rs. 7–25 LPA.
Which is better — CA or BBA?
CA offers higher salary (7–25 LPA) but takes 5 years and is competitive. BBA is a 3-year degree and a gateway to MBA from IIMs. Choose CA for specialised finance; BBA for broader management exposure.
